About Clock/Timing - Clock Buffers, Drivers


Clock buffers and drivers are integrated circuits used to distribute clock signals with minimal distortion and delay to multiple components within a digital system. They provide signal buffering, amplification, and fan-out capabilities to ensure reliable clock distribution and synchronization across the system.
